The Concept of Tokenization
Tokenization refers to the process of converting real-world assets into digital tokens on a blockchain. These tokens represent ownership or a stake in an underlying asset, which could range from commodities like gold and oil to more complex assets like real estate and intellectual property. The beauty of this concept lies in its ability to make these traditionally illiquid assets more accessible, liquid, and divisible.
The RWA Commodities Angle
When we talk about RWA commodities tokenization, we are specifically discussing the conversion of tangible commodities into digital tokens. Commodities such as gold, oil, and agricultural products have always been central to economies worldwide. Tokenizing these commodities brings a new level of transparency, efficiency, and accessibility.
Why Tokenization Matters
Increased Accessibility: Traditional commodities often require substantial capital to trade. Tokenization lowers the entry barriers, allowing a broader range of investors to participate. This democratization of access can lead to more diverse ownership and investment strategies.
Liquidity: Commodities are typically illiquid assets, often held for long periods. Tokenization introduces liquidity, enabling investors to buy, sell, or trade fractional shares instantly.
Fractional Ownership: Tokenization allows assets to be divided into smaller units. This means that even small investors can own a fraction of a commodity, thereby democratizing wealth and investment opportunities.
Transparency: Blockchain technology provides an immutable ledger that records all transactions. This transparency helps to reduce fraud and ensures that all parties have access to the same information, enhancing trust.
The Role of Blockchain
At the heart of RWA commodities tokenization is blockchain technology. Blockchain provides a decentralized, secure, and transparent platform for recording transactions. Smart contracts, self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code, automate and enforce the terms of token transfers. This reduces the need for intermediaries, thereby cutting down costs and eliminating delays.
Challenges on the Horizon
While the potential of RWA commodities tokenization is immense, it is not without challenges. Some of the key concerns include:
Regulatory Hurdles: As with any new financial innovation, regulatory frameworks are catching up. Ensuring compliance while fostering innovation is a delicate balance that regulators need to navigate.
Technological Barriers: The technology needs to be robust and scalable to handle large volumes of transactions without compromising speed or security.
Market Adoption: Convincing traditional financial institutions and investors to adopt this new method will require education and demonstration of tangible benefits.

The Intersection of Technology and Sustainability
At the heart of this initiative lies blockchain technology, a decentralized system that offers unprecedented transparency and security. By leveraging this technology, recycling programs can track and verify each recycling action, ensuring that rewards are earned fairly and transparently. Unlike traditional recycling systems that rely on centralized authorities, this decentralized approach empowers individuals and communities to take charge of their environmental impact.
How It Works: The Mechanics of Earning Crypto for Recycling
Imagine a world where you can earn cryptocurrency simply by recycling your plastic bottles, paper, and electronic waste. Here's how it works:
Participation in a Decentralized Recycling Program: You join a decentralized recycling program that utilizes blockchain to track your contributions.
Recycling Actions: You carry out your recycling efforts as you normally would, ensuring that items are properly sorted and disposed of.
Blockchain Verification: Each recycling action is recorded on the blockchain, providing a transparent and immutable ledger of your contributions.
Reward Distribution: Based on the verified data, you receive cryptocurrency rewards directly to your digital wallet. These rewards can be used, traded, or held as investment.
